About Maria Valérien Mertl
Maria Valérien Mertl is a Verkaufsleiterin at Crain Communications, where she has worked since 2018. She specializes in organizing events and advising companies on market communication strategies within the automotive industry.
Work at Crain Communications
Maria Valérien Mertl has been serving as Verkaufsleiterin at Crain Communications since 2018. In this role, she is based in Oberpfaffenhofen and has accumulated six years of experience. Her responsibilities include overseeing sales operations and engaging with key stakeholders in the automotive industry. Mertl is involved in organizing and sponsoring high-profile live and digital events, such as the Automobilwoche Kongress, which showcases her commitment to enhancing industry connections.
Education and Expertise
Maria Valérien Mertl studied at the Verwaltungs- und Wirtschaftsakademie, where she focused on Betriebswirtschaftslehre (BWL) and earned the title of Betriebswirtin (VWA) from 2003 to 2006. She furthered her education at the Bayerische Akademie für Werbung (BAW), specializing in Marketing and achieving the Dialogmarketing-Fachwirtin qualification, recognized as a European diploma in direct and interactive marketing (FEDMA) from 2008 to 2009.
Background
Before joining Crain Communications, Mertl held significant positions in the marketing field. She worked as Marketingleitung at Printwerk e.K. from 2016 to 2018, where she managed marketing strategies in Augsburg und Umgebung, Deutschland. Prior to that, she served as Anzeigenleitung at BAUER ADVERTISING KG / BAUER PREMIUM from 2012 to 2015, leading sales for publications such as JOY and SHAPE in München.
Industry Involvement
Mertl works closely with Automobilwoche, a prominent B2B newspaper in Germany that is part of the Automotive News Group. She has access to a premium target group that includes car manufacturers, suppliers, car dealerships, and service providers. Her role involves advising companies on market communication strategies tailored to decision-makers in the automotive sector, utilizing a diverse portfolio that encompasses print and online products, webcasts, and web seminars.
